sysstatemgmt/ssmcmdlists/data/securitycheckcmdlist.rss
branchRCL_3
changeset 61 8cb079868133
parent 60 ccb4f6b3db21
equal deleted inserted replaced
60:ccb4f6b3db21 61:8cb079868133
     1 /*
     1 /*
     2 * Copyright (c) 2009 - 2010 Nokia Corporation and/or its subsidiary(-ies).
     2 * Copyright (c) 2009-2010 Nokia Corporation and/or its subsidiary(-ies).
     3 * All rights reserved.
     3 * All rights reserved.
     4 * This component and the accompanying materials are made available
     4 * This component and the accompanying materials are made available
     5 * under the terms of "Eclipse Public License v1.0"
     5 * under the terms of "Eclipse Public License v1.0"
     6 * which accompanies this distribution, and is available
     6 * which accompanies this distribution, and is available
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
    67         {
    67         {
    68         r_cmd_sastate,      // This needs to be the first command in state, prio 0xFFF2
    68         r_cmd_sastate,      // This needs to be the first command in state, prio 0xFFF2
    69         r_cmd_publishstate, // prio 0xFFF1
    69         r_cmd_publishstate, // prio 0xFFF1
    70         r_cmd_psstate,      // prio 0xFFF0
    70         r_cmd_psstate,      // prio 0xFFF0
    71         // prio 0xFFE7
    71         // prio 0xFFE7
       
    72 		r_cmd_menu,
    72         r_cmd_idle,
    73         r_cmd_idle,
    73 	    // prio 0xFFE6
    74         // prio 0xFFE6
    74         r_cmd_multiwaitforever1,
    75         r_cmd_multiwaitforever1,
    75         // prio 0xFFE3
    76         // prio 0xFFE3
    76         r_cmd_startup,
    77         r_cmd_startup,
    77         r_cmd_phone,
    78         r_cmd_phone,
    78         r_cmd_clockserver,
    79         r_cmd_nitz,
       
    80         // prio 0xFFE2
    79         r_cmd_multiwaitforever2,
    81         r_cmd_multiwaitforever2,
       
    82         // prio 0xFFDF
       
    83         r_cmd_touchscreen,
       
    84         r_cmd_touchplg,
       
    85         // prio 0xFFDE
       
    86         r_cmd_multiwaitforever3,
    80         // prio 0xFFD8
    87         // prio 0xFFD8
    81         r_cmd_createswp_simstatus,
    88         r_cmd_createswp_simstatus,
    82         // prio 0xFFD7
    89         // prio 0xFFD7
    83         r_cmd_loadsup_simeventobserver,
    90         r_cmd_loadsup_simeventobserver,
    84         // prio 0xFFD6
    91         // prio 0xFFD6
    88 
    95 
    89 // ===========================================================================
    96 // ===========================================================================
    90 // Command items in alphabetical order
    97 // Command items in alphabetical order
    91 // ===========================================================================
    98 // ===========================================================================
    92 //
    99 //
    93 // -----------------------------------------------------------------------------
   100 
    94 // r_cmd_clockserver
       
    95 // ---------------------------------------------------------------------------
       
    96 //
       
    97 RESOURCE SSM_START_PROCESS_INFO r_cmd_clockserver
       
    98 	{
       
    99 	priority = 0xFFE3;
       
   100 	name = "clockserver.exe";
       
   101 	execution_behaviour = ESsmDeferredWaitForSignal;
       
   102 	}
       
   103 	
       
   104 // ---------------------------------------------------------------------------
   101 // ---------------------------------------------------------------------------
   105 // r_cmd_createswp_simstatus
   102 // r_cmd_createswp_simstatus
   106 // ---------------------------------------------------------------------------
   103 // ---------------------------------------------------------------------------
   107 //
   104 //
   108 RESOURCE SSM_CREATE_SYSTEM_WIDE_PROPERTY r_cmd_createswp_simstatus
   105 RESOURCE SSM_CREATE_SYSTEM_WIDE_PROPERTY r_cmd_createswp_simstatus
   111     severity = ECmdCriticalSeverity;
   108     severity = ECmdCriticalSeverity;
   112     key = 0x00000031; // KPSSimStatus
   109     key = 0x00000031; // KPSSimStatus
   113     filename = "ssm.swp.policy.simstatus.dll";
   110     filename = "ssm.swp.policy.simstatus.dll";
   114     }
   111     }
   115 
   112 
   116     
       
   117 // ---------------------------------------------------------------------------
   113 // ---------------------------------------------------------------------------
   118 // r_cmd_idle
   114 // r_cmd_idle
   119 // ---------------------------------------------------------------------------
   115 // ---------------------------------------------------------------------------
   120 //
   116 //
   121 RESOURCE SSM_START_APP_INFO r_cmd_idle
   117 RESOURCE SSM_START_PROCESS_INFO r_cmd_idle
   122     {
   118     {
   123     priority = 0xFFE7;
   119     priority = 0xFFE7;
   124     name = "z:\\sys\\bin\\hsapplicationlauncher.exe";
   120     name = "z:\\sys\\bin\\ailaunch.exe";
   125     execution_behaviour = ESsmDeferredWaitForSignal;
   121     execution_behaviour = ESsmDeferredWaitForSignal;
   126     monitor_info = r_mon_max_restarts_ignore;
   122     monitor_info = r_mon_max_restarts_ignore;
   127     }
   123     }
   128 
   124 
   129 // ---------------------------------------------------------------------------
   125 // ---------------------------------------------------------------------------
       
   126 // r_cmd_menu
       
   127 // ---------------------------------------------------------------------------
       
   128 //
       
   129 RESOURCE SSM_START_APP_INFO r_cmd_menu
       
   130     {
       
   131     priority = 0xFFE7;
       
   132     name = "z:\\sys\\bin\\matrixmenu.exe";
       
   133     execution_behaviour = ESsmDeferredWaitForSignal;
       
   134     background = 1; // To background
       
   135     }
       
   136 
       
   137 // ---------------------------------------------------------------------------
   130 // r_cmd_multiwaitforever1
   138 // r_cmd_multiwaitforever1
   131 // ---------------------------------------------------------------------------
   139 // ---------------------------------------------------------------------------
   132 //
   140 //
   133 RESOURCE SSM_MULTIPLE_WAIT r_cmd_multiwaitforever1
   141 RESOURCE SSM_MULTIPLE_WAIT r_cmd_multiwaitforever1
   134     {
   142     {
   142 RESOURCE SSM_MULTIPLE_WAIT r_cmd_multiwaitforever2
   150 RESOURCE SSM_MULTIPLE_WAIT r_cmd_multiwaitforever2
   143     {
   151     {
   144     priority = 0xFFE2;
   152     priority = 0xFFE2;
   145     }
   153     }
   146 
   154 
       
   155 // ---------------------------------------------------------------------------
       
   156 // r_cmd_multiwaitforever3
       
   157 // ---------------------------------------------------------------------------
       
   158 //
       
   159 RESOURCE SSM_MULTIPLE_WAIT r_cmd_multiwaitforever3
       
   160     {
       
   161     priority = 0xFFDE;
       
   162     }
       
   163 
       
   164 // ---------------------------------------------------------------------------
       
   165 // r_cmd_nitz
       
   166 // ---------------------------------------------------------------------------
       
   167 //
       
   168 RESOURCE SSM_START_PROCESS_INFO r_cmd_nitz
       
   169     {
       
   170     priority = 0xFFE3;
       
   171     name = "z:\\sys\\bin\\clockserver.exe";
       
   172     execution_behaviour = ESsmFireAndForget; // -- does not call Rendezvous() --
       
   173     monitor_info = r_mon_3_restarts_ignore;
       
   174     }
   147 
   175 
   148 // ---------------------------------------------------------------------------
   176 // ---------------------------------------------------------------------------
   149 // r_cmd_phone
   177 // r_cmd_phone
   150 // ---------------------------------------------------------------------------
   178 // ---------------------------------------------------------------------------
   151 //
   179 //
   234     execution_behaviour = ESsmDeferredWaitForSignal;
   262     execution_behaviour = ESsmDeferredWaitForSignal;
   235     severity = ECmdCriticalSeverity;
   263     severity = ECmdCriticalSeverity;
   236     retries = 2;
   264     retries = 2;
   237     }
   265     }
   238 
   266 
       
   267 // ---------------------------------------------------------------------------
       
   268 // r_cmd_touchplg
       
   269 // ---------------------------------------------------------------------------
       
   270 //
       
   271 RESOURCE SSM_START_CUSTOM_COMMAND r_cmd_touchplg
       
   272     {
       
   273     priority = 0xFFDF;
       
   274     severity = ECmdCriticalSeverity;
       
   275     dllname = "tsccustcmds.dll";
       
   276     ordinal = 1;
       
   277     retries = 2;
       
   278     execution_behaviour = ESsmDeferredWaitForSignal;
       
   279     conditional_information = r_cond_firstboot_and_tscinstartup;
       
   280     }
       
   281 
       
   282 // ---------------------------------------------------------------------------
       
   283 // r_cmd_touchscreen
       
   284 // ---------------------------------------------------------------------------
       
   285 //
       
   286 RESOURCE SSM_START_PROCESS_INFO r_cmd_touchscreen
       
   287     {
       
   288     priority = 0xFFDF;
       
   289     name = "z:\\sys\\bin\\touchscreencalib.exe";
       
   290     execution_behaviour = ESsmDeferredWaitForSignal;
       
   291     conditional_information = r_cond_firstboot_and_tscinstartup;
       
   292     }
   239 
   293 
   240 // ===========================================================================
   294 // ===========================================================================
   241 // DLL data items in alphabetical order
   295 // DLL data items in alphabetical order
   242 // ===========================================================================
   296 // ===========================================================================
   243 //
   297 //